Output 7a28308cb31c0576f43e96fe66c4f531eba2b81487edc9c3226c6fb878beeb86:4

value
370884
script pubkey
OP_0 OP_PUSHBYTES_20 2613ce79309020b403a7a5839ef07426e69aa2d7
address
bc1qycfuu7fsjqstgqa85kpeaur5ymnf4gkhwavtlj
transaction
7a28308cb31c0576f43e96fe66c4f531eba2b81487edc9c3226c6fb878beeb86
confirmations
104953
spent
true